‘James Caird’ Replica Goes to Scott Polar Institute

I met up with Trevor Potts, Antarctic adventurer and historian, in Ardnamurchan last year, having been introduced to him on my 1st Antarctica trip in 2003. He was the first man to successfully re-create Sir Ernest Shackleton’s 1916 epic rescue voyage from Elephant Island to South Georgia in the 23ft whaler, the James Caird. The picture shows Trevor with ‘Sir Ernest Shackleton’, his replica of Shackleton’s boat, which will shortly travel to Cambridge to be displayed at the Scott Polar Institute. The original whaler, ‘James Caird’ is on permanent display at Shackleton’s old school, Dulwich College in London.
